"""Integrated Global Radiosonde Archive (IGRA) version 2 reader (spec §3.4).
:func:`read` takes one ascent from an IGRA v2 per-station file — the
as-distributed ``.zip`` or the extracted ``.txt``, sniffed with
``zipfile.is_zipfile`` rather than by suffix — parsing the fixed-width
records per NCEI's ``igra2-data-format.txt``: pressure in Pa, temperature
and dewpoint depression in tenths of °C, wind in degrees and tenths of
m s⁻¹, with the missing-value sentinels reading as NaN and dewpoint
derived as temperature minus depression. Unreadable, malformed, or
ambiguous input raises :class:`~tephpy.exceptions.TephpyIOError`; the
returned sounding passes the ordinary ingest validation (spec §6).
"""

def _sounding(lines: list[str], header: _Header) -> Sounding:
"""Parse one ascent's records into a sounding.
Records without a pressure value are dropped (`Sounding` requires
finite pressure), the sentinels read as NaN, dewpoint derives as
temperature minus dewpoint depression, and rows whose pressure does
not strictly undercut the running minimum drop keeping the first
occurrence. An optional field that is entirely NaN is treated as
absent — and the wind pair as a unit, so a one-sided wind column
passes as absent rather than as barbs that cannot draw — keeping
the missing-data errors meaningful downstream (spec §6).
